The return of measles to the United States — with over 2,280 cases in 2025 and more than 1,100 in just the first two months of 2026 — has generated an estimated $244 million in direct economic costs and counting. But the true toll, from immune amnesia that leaves survivors vulnerable for years, to fatal neurological complications that surface a decade later, to exhausted rural health departments diverting resources from other emergencies, defies any spreadsheet.
